Tile is one of those finishes where the difference between a good install and a bad one shows up years later. Bad waterproofing means a shower that fails. Bad substrate prep means cracked grout lines and loose tiles. Bad layout planning means awkward cuts in the most visible spots. We approach every tile job with the substrate, the waterproofing, and the layout planned first — then the tile goes down. Whether it's a small backsplash or a full bathroom with heated floors and a curbless shower, we hold to the same standards: tight grout lines, plumb and level surfaces, and waterproofing systems installed exactly to manufacturer spec.

Frequently asked questions

How much does tile installation cost?

Most tile installs run $12–$25 per square foot installed for standard tile, more for large-format, mosaic, or natural stone. Shower builds run $4,000–$12,000 depending on size and waterproofing system. We provide a do-not-exceed estimate before starting.

What waterproofing system do you use for showers?

We typically use Schluter KERDI or USG Durock systems — full sheet membrane or liquid-applied — depending on the build. Proper waterproofing is the single biggest factor in whether a shower lasts 20 years or fails in 5.

Can you install heated floors?

Yes. We install electric radiant heat mats (Schluter DITRA-HEAT, Warmly Yours, SunTouch) under tile floors in bathrooms, kitchens, mudrooms, and basements. Heated tile floors are one of the highest-value upgrades for the cost.

Do you do large-format tile and natural stone?

Yes — large-format porcelain (24×48 and bigger), marble, travertine, slate, and quartzite. Large-format tile requires a perfectly flat substrate and back-buttering; we prep accordingly so you don't get lippage.

Can you replace a few cracked or loose tiles?

Yes, we take on tile repair as small projects. Matching grout and finding a tile that matches the original is the hard part — bring us a sample or extra tile if you have any.
